**Ticket: Scanner double-fires on quick successive scans**

Hey support folks — heads up on the Brightbin barcode scanner integration. When a warehouse user scans two items within about half a second, the second scan sometimes registers twice, so counts come out inflated. Workaround for now: tell users to pause briefly between scans, or manually correct the count in Stockline. Fix is queued for the next point release; we added a debounce. If customers ask which version has the bug, reference the build below.

trace token, fafog-kageg: htk4_98e6

Welcome to the Torvane firmware team. Devices pull updates from the Ridgecap channel. Channels: stable, beta, canary. New hires get canary only. The updater daemon reads .env in /opt/ridgecap. Set CHANNEL=canary and REGION to your lab's code. Do not edit the manifest URL line; ops owns it. Builds publish nightly; flash a spare unit before touching hardware on the bench. Finish setup by adding the channel signing secret on the next line of .env.

sealed setting: RELAY_SECRET5=82864

Welcome to the BranchSweep review! Quick context: BranchSweep is our bot that flags and deletes branches untouched for 90+ days across the Quillhaven monorepo. It runs under a scoped service account with delete rights only on `stale/*` refs. If the bot's credentials ever get wedged, recovery goes through the Mosswick vault, which unlocks with the passphrase noted just below.

unlock words, bahop-fawef: novmir-druwyn-soriel-rusdor-kasion

Subject: Ledger handover

Taking over PointsKeep? Short version: the loyalty-points ledger is append-only; never UPDATE rows, only insert adjustments. Nightly reconciliation runs at 02:10 and flags drift in the audit table. Escrow balances for the Marlowe tier are computed on read, so don't cache them. Everything else is in the wiki. The ledger connects with the connection string below.

replica DSN, yahaf-yagaf: mongodb://tamath_svc:a2netSk3RZMuTj@db-d084.novacsoft.internal:5432/ralmir